Security drones function in the following ways:

#1. Authentication

The authentication process guarantees that only approved users can control the drone. By this, you will have complete control over your security drones and only provide access to your desired security personnel. Various methods, including passwords and biometrics, are available for this purpose.

#2. Distant Control Function

Drones can be remotely piloted from the ground, providing increased oversight and management of the drone’s operations. Usually, security drone for home is highly affected due to this function, especially if you have vast lands that need monitoring.

Homeowners with farms, livestock, and even businesses in their homes can have drone security to efficiently optimize security without getting to do it themselves on the ground.

#3. Counter-drone Technology

Anti-drone technologies are used to identify and stop the usage of illegal drones. Drone-detection systems may use radar, radio frequency scanners, and other sensors.

The ability to shut down illicit drones wandering around your property without endangering life makes drone security a better option for these matters. #4. Data Encryption

You can avoid invasion of privacy thanks to the advancement of data encryptions integrated into your security drones. Users can encrypt the information the drone gathers or transmits for security purposes. As a result, only approved individuals will access the data, which will be safe from hackers and other intruders.

#5. Geofencing

Your main interest in security drones is their ability to safeguard your parameters. Geofencing uses global positioning system data To set up a virtual perimeter around a geographical location.

Users can utilize this to keep unmanned aircraft from approaching unsafe levels of proximity to critical infrastructure or prohibited zones. Anywhere beyond the fence is outside the drone scope and thus also safeguarding drones from getting lost or shut down.

#7. Protects Life Endangerment

Drones can swiftly survey an area from above, identify potential dangers, and transmit live video and photos. As a result, security personnel can gauge the severity of the threat and take the necessary precautions.

Your on-ground security personnel no longer have to risk their lives checking on risky and remote areas of your land as drones can hover and fly through them with the breeze.

Integrating Security Drone For Home Use: Consider These Factors

Although security drones are promising, there are several aspects to consider before integrating a security drone for residential use. Some things to keep an eye out for are:

  • Concerns Laws and Regulations

There are moral concerns before drone surveillance, especially for industrial purposes. Deploying drones for security purposes necessitates familiarity with applicable local rules and regulations.

However, having a drone at home like the ring security drone may not threaten local people. You can still ask the drone provider regarding the policies you need to adhere to avoid lawsuits.

  • Cost Effectivity

The more advanced and advanced functions a security drone has, the higher the price tag will be. You need to consider how much money you can afford to spend and if the extra safety measures are worth it.

  • Agility and Battery Life

If you have a vast property, you should think carefully about the drone’s range and battery life. Check the drone’s range and battery life to ensure it can effectively monitor the places you need it to and last long as you expect.

  • The Simplicity of Use and Convenience

It would help if you looked for a simple drone to assemble and use with straightforward menus and a clean design.   • Drone Upkeep

A drone service provider must be accessible for your reach, and parts that need changing should be easily accessible and inexpensive. Consider the price and access to repair services if the drone breaks down or needs regular upkeep. If you want your drones to last long, you can opt for a drone with carbon fiber bodies for robust hardware.

  • Data Security

If you want to protect your neighbors’ personal space while using a drone, you should talk to them about it. Also, think about your personal space and whether or not you want a drone flying around your house taking pictures.
